Abstract

The invention discloses a metal restoration additive for lubricating oil of an engine. The metal restoration additive is characterized by consisting of the following components in percentage by weight: 3 to 5 percent of polyisobutene, 5 to 8 percent of dialkyl dithiophosphate, 4 to 6 percent of phosphite ester, 8 to 10 percent of tert-butyl phenyl phosphate, 5 to 7 percent of alkyl methacrylate copolymer, 3 percent of sulfurized calcium alkyl phenolate, 3 to 5 percent of nanometer copper oxide powder, 2 to 4 percent of nanometer magnesium powder and the balance of base oil. A method is simple and practicable; and the prepared restoration additive for the engine powerfully functions in the restoration of various engines, has low cost and the good effects of wear resistance and fuel saving, can prolong the service life of the engine and a drain period, is safe to use and does not have any corrosion action on the engine.

Description

A kind of engine metal repair additive
(1) technical field
The present invention relates to a kind of lubricating oil additive, particularly a kind of engine oil metallic prosthetic additive.
(2) background technology
Additive is a kind of material that can give and improve lubricants performance.Along with the continuous development of engine technology, the release of various new technologies is also had higher requirement to various lubricated oil propertiess and performance.One of motive force of development of current each class lubricating oil is the protection environment.And the use of current each type lubricating oil additive improves to some performance of engine really, but also has some additives to have a strong impact on the works better of engine really.The additive that has has formed corrosion and oxidation to engine, and the additive that has has formed more carbon deposit to engine.Though some additive has certain effect on the market, but do not reach environmental requirement, and cost an arm and a leg poor effect.
(3) summary of the invention
The objective of the invention is the problem that exists in the above-mentioned technology, providing a kind of has obvious repair to engine, without any side effects to engine, and can guarantee the lubricant effect of engine for a long time, prolong the drain period, reduce production costs the better lubricating oil additive of performance.
Technical scheme of the present invention:
A kind of engine oil metallic prosthetic additive, essential characteristic is: by base oil; Polyisobutene; Dialkyl dithiophosphate; Phosphorous acid ester; The tert-butylation phenyl phosphate ester; The alkyl methacrylate multipolymer; Alkyl monosulfide powder calcium; The nano level cupric oxide powder; Nano level magnesium powder is formed.The weight percent of each component is: polyisobutene 3-5%; Dialkyl dithiophosphate 5-8%; Phosphorous acid ester 46%; Tert-butylation phenyl phosphate ester 8-10%; Alkyl methacrylate multipolymer 5-7%; Alkyl monosulfide powder calcium 3%; Nano level cupric oxide powder 3-5%; Nano level magnesium powder 2-4%; Surplus is a base oil.
A kind of above-mentioned engine oil metallic prosthetic additive, essential characteristic is: base oil is 150BS, 500SN, 5 centistokes, any two kinds of components in 10 centistokes or the combination of three kinds of components, the weight quota ratio of each component is 1: 1: 1.
A kind of above-mentioned engine oil metallic prosthetic additive, essential characteristic is: the mean particle size of nano level cupric oxide powder and nano level magnesium powder is 30-40nm.
A kind of above-mentioned engine oil metallic prosthetic additive, essential characteristic is: with base oil; Polyisobutene; Dialkyl dithiophosphate; Phosphorous acid ester; The tert-butylation phenyl phosphate ester; The alkyl methacrylate multipolymer; Alkyl monosulfide powder calcium; Mix, heat and controlled temperature in 55-60 ℃, stirred 180-240 minute, promptly get this product after the filtration.
A kind of above-mentioned engine oil metallic prosthetic additive, essential characteristic is: the weight ratio by 2-6% when needing with the replacing engine oil when this product uses is added to sump simultaneously.Also can be added in the lubricating oil fuel tank of this product in the 2-6% ratio.
Advantage of the present invention: this method is simple and practical, the engine repair additive that makes, all kinds of engines all there is very strong repair, the product cost that makes is low, and the effect height can prolong engine work-ing life, prolong the drain period, have wear-resistant, as to save fuel oil effect, safe in utilization, to engine without any corrosive nature.
(4) embodiment
Embodiment 1
A kind of engine repair additive is by base oil; Polyisobutene; Dialkyl dithiophosphate; Phosphorous acid ester; The tert-butylation phenyl phosphate ester; The alkyl methacrylate multipolymer; Alkyl monosulfide powder calcium; The nano level cupric oxide powder; Nano level magnesium powder is formed.Base oil 150BS and 500SN, 5 centistokes.The weight quota of each component is 1: 1: 1; The weight percent of each component is a polyisobutene 3%; Dialkyl dithiophosphate 5%; Phosphorous acid ester 4%; Tert-butylation phenyl phosphate ester 8%; Alkyl methacrylate multipolymer 5%; Alkyl monosulfide powder calcium 3%; Nano level cupric oxide powder 3%; Nano level magnesium powder 2%.Base oil 67%.With above-mentioned base oil; Polyisobutene; Dialkyl dithiophosphate; Phosphorous acid ester; The tert-butylation phenyl phosphate ester; The alkyl methacrylate multipolymer; Alkyl monosulfide powder calcium; The nano level cupric oxide powder; Nano level magnesium powder mixes.Heating also, controlled temperature stirred 180 minutes in 55-60 ℃.Promptly get this product after overanxious.This product is joined the engine oil fuel tank in 3% ratio, draws down routine conclusion:
1. the extreme-pressure anti-wear index is improved more than 45%, and long mill wear scar diameter reduces more than 50%.
2. engine noise obviously reduces.
3. the oil product lubricant effect is outstanding, can save fuel oil 6%.
4. prolong 1.5 times of drain periods.
Embodiment 2
A kind of engine repair additive is by base oil; Polyisobutene; Dialkyl dithiophosphate; Phosphorous acid ester; The tert-butylation phenyl phosphate ester; The alkyl methacrylate multipolymer; Alkyl monosulfide powder calcium; The nano level cupric oxide powder; Nano level magnesium powder is formed.Base oil 150BS and 10 centistokes.The weight quota of each component is 1: 1; The weight percent of each component is a polyisobutene 5%; Dialkyl dithiophosphate 8%; Phosphorous acid ester 6%; Tert-butylation phenyl phosphate ester 10%; Alkyl methacrylate multipolymer 7%; Alkyl monosulfide powder calcium 3%; Nano level cupric oxide powder 5%; Nano level magnesium powder 4%.Base oil 52%.With above-mentioned base oil; Polyisobutene; Dialkyl dithiophosphate; Phosphorous acid ester; The tert-butylation phenyl phosphate ester; The alkyl methacrylate multipolymer; Alkyl monosulfide powder calcium; The nano level cupric oxide powder; Nano level magnesium powder mixes.Heating also, controlled temperature stirred 240 minutes in 55-60 ℃.Promptly get this product after overanxious.This product is joined the engine oil fuel tank in 3% ratio, draws down routine conclusion:
1. the extreme-pressure anti-wear index is improved more than 50%, and long mill wear scar diameter reduces more than 60%.
2. engine noise obviously reduces.
3. the oil product lubricant effect is outstanding, can save fuel oil 8%.
4. prolong 2 times of drain periods.
